Quality Control Chemist
Quality Control Chemist
VIVUS, Inc. is a specialty pharmaceutical company focused on research, development and commercialization of products to restore sexual function. In addition to currently marketed therapies, VIVUS, Inc. has a strong pipeline that includes both new and existing chemical compounds that can be developed to address unmet medical needs. VIVUS’ business strategy applies the Company’s scientific and medical expertise to identify, develop and commercialize therapies that restore sexual function. We're seeking a hands-on team player to join our Quality group as a Quality Control Chemist at our Lakewood, NJ facility.
The selected candidate will be primarily responsible for conducting routine and non-routine analysis of raw materials, in-process, and finished products according to standard operating procedures.
Other duties will include: complies data for documentation of test results; reviews and verifies laboratory data generated by other personnel; calibrates and/or maintains laboratory equipment; performs instrumental analysis in accordance with standard test methods and compendial procedures; participates in SOP review/revision process; may perform special projects on analytical and instrumental problem solving; adheres to company SOPs and practices GMPs on a daily basis; normally receives minimal instructions on routine work, detailed instructions on new assignments; works on problems of diverse scope where analysis or data requires evaluation of identifiable factors; performs other duties as assigned.
Candidates must have at least 2+ years of relevant experience in a laboratory environment; BS in scientific discipline; exercises judgment within defined procedures and practices to determine appropriate action; proficient use of personal computer (MS Word, Excel, Windows, etc.); possesses good communication and interpersonal skills.
